Iyabo Ojo, a Nollywood actress and businesswoman, responded after Lizzy Anjorin failed to appear in court for their hearing.
According to a video posted by the actress on her Instagram page just minutes ago, Lizzy Anjorin did not appear in court with the aforementioned proof.
Iyabo Ojo and her lawyer, who talked in the video, said that the matter has been extended to April 10th, and the court will issue another order to her colleague.
The mother of two further criticized Lizzy Anjorin, claiming that if she does not accept the revised order, it would be put all over her wall to remind her of the hearing date. Iyabo Ojo captioned the video.
“April 10th is round the corner……. the court will be serving you once again, Liz, and this time, the court has given the order for it to be pasted everywhere on your wall if you don’t accept it ……. this court se, we must go and you must bring all your evidence 😉 by force by fire”
Months ago, it was claimed that Iyabo Ojo and Lizzy Anjorin caused a sensation on the internet by openly washing their filthy laundry.
Iyabo Ojo released a video in which she hilariously mimicked and mocked Lizzy Anjorin. Lizzy was clearly angered by this and went on to divulge some sensitive facts about Iyabo Ojo, accusing her of promiscuity and being a Gistlover, among other things.
Following the charges, Iyabo Ojo warned Lizzy with legal action, demanding a public apology or paying N500 million for her libelous publication, and warning that if her demands were not satisfied, she would be sued for N1 billion.
